packet: in packet_snd start writing at link layer allocation
Packet sockets allow construction of packets shorter than dev->hard_header_len to accommodate protocols with variable length link layer headers. These packets are padded to dev->hard_header_len, because some device drivers interpret that as a minimum packet size. packet_snd reserves dev->hard_header_len bytes on allocation. SOCK_DGRAM sockets call skb_push in dev_hard_header() to ensure that link layer headers are stored in the reserved range. SOCK_RAW sockets do the same in tpacket_snd, but not in packet_snd. Syzbot was able to send a zero byte packet to a device with massive 116B link layer header, causing padding to cross over into skb_shinfo. Fix this by writing from the start of the llheader reserved range also in the case of packet_snd/SOCK_RAW. Update skb_set_network_header to the new offset. This also corrects it for SOCK_DGRAM, where it incorrectly double counted reserve due to the skb_push in dev_hard_header.
